The self-employment company Invoicery Group increased revenue and significantly improved earnings during the second quarter.Revenue rose 5.9 percent to SEK 501.3 million (473.3).Ebitda amounted to SEK 5.3 million (2.7).Operating profit increased to SEK 4.7 million (1.9).Net profit amounted to SEK 4.0 million (1.7). Earnings per share amounted to SEK 0.14 (0.06).Cash and cash equivalents amounted to SEK 110.0 million (89.9) at the end of the period.CEO Stephen Schad said that the improvement in earnings reflects solid revenue growth as well as the effects of the cost efficiencies implemented over the past year.At the same time, the international operations continued to develop well and increased revenue by 19.4 percent during the quarter. The company's vision of becoming the leading portal for assignment-based work in Europe remains unchanged.No forecast is provided.Key figures, SEK millionQ2-2026Q2-2025Year-over-year changeRevenue501.3473.35.9%Ebitda5.32.796.7%Operating profit4.71.9144.0%Net profit4.01.7130.6%Earnings per share, SEK0.140.06133.3%Cash and cash equivalents110.089.922.5%
